With the continuous development of powder coating technology, electrostatic powder coating on the surface of aluminum profile is widely used by the current powder coating technology because of its unique advantages. The main features are that the recycling rate is up to more than 95%, does not pollute the environment, does not need preheating, powder coating can be carried out under normal temperature conditions, thick film can be formed at one time, and hanging flow will not occur, etc. Powder coating includes air spraying method, fluidized bed dip coating method, electrostatic fluidized bed dip coating method, electrostatic powder spraying method, flame spraying method and electric field corona spraying method.

Air Spraying Method
Place the powder coating in the spray gun and use the adsorption force of compressed air to adsorb the coating on the surface of the pre preheated aluminum profile. The powder is melted on the surface of aluminum profile. Thermoplastic and thermosetting powder can be used. If it is thermosetting powder, it should be solidified in the oven. This spraying method is suitable for the surface of a small aluminum profile.
Electrostatic Powder Spraying
This is the most widely used powder spraying method at present. It uses the principle of electrostatic adsorption to make the powder coating induced by electrostatic carry opposite charges and adsorb to the surface of aluminum profile. Both thermal spraying and cold spraying can be carried out. After spraying, it needs to be dried in the baking furnace. This spraying method is suitable for the surface of aluminum profiles of different sizes and shapes. Both thermoplastic and thermosetting powders can be used.
Fluidized Bed Dip Coating Method
First preheat the aluminum profile and then immerse it into the powder coating fluidized bed to melt the powder to the surface of the aluminum profile. The thermoplastic and thermosetting powder can be used. If it is thermosetting powder, it should also be solidified in the oven. This spraying method is suitable for the surface of small aluminum profile with film thickness, as well as medium-sized pipelines or metal mesh, which can be dip-coated in an all-round way.
Electric Field Corona Coating Method
Place the thermoplastic or thermosetting powder between two parallel electrodes to make the powder coating charged. Pass the coated object between the electrodes to make its surface absorb the powder. A fluidized bed shall be placed under the device, and the spraying material shall be sprayed from the nozzle of the ejector, which is suitable for spraying (10-20) with a thin coating μ m) Small aluminum profile.
Impact Coating Method
This spraying method is also called mechanical spraying method. Powders with different particle sizes are mixed with glass beads in a certain proportion and sprayed by the nozzle of the ejector. The powder is deposited on the surface of aluminum profile under the impact of glass beads. This method is suitable for spraying thinner film (2-10) μ m) Aluminum profile.
Electrostatic Fluidized Bed Dip Coating
This spraying method combines the fluidized bed dip coating method with electrostatic powder spraying. Thermoplastic and thermosetting powders are used, which is suitable for film thickness of 150 μ m.
